Crews are 'ready to go' on $250 million Muskegon Lake development

Booking.com

Adelaide Pointe's ability to dock large boats could drive tourism to the area, say officials.

After months of public hearings and planning, construction is set to begin this month on a $250 million Muskegon Lake development known as “Adelaide Pointe.”

The new development includes a new hotel, condominiums, pool, restaurant, event space, boat sales and boat rentals.

It also includes a new marina that can handle large boats and yachts, something that the city of Muskegon currently doesn’t have. That’s good for the city’s vision of expanding tourism to the area, says Muskegon Lakeshore Chamber President, Cindy Larson.

“We are doing a good job at planning a downtown and waterfront that our children, grand children and great grand children will enjoy for years to come,” she said.

Located on a formal industrial site, the development will include public green space and the re-launching of the Muskegon Brewing Company, with Pigeon Hill behind the beer craftifishingng.

The project is expected to be constructed by June 2024.
